Informa in talks to acquire Springer Science - November 25, 2009
Media company Informa, UK, has confirmed that it is in talks to acquire German academic publisher Springer Science and Business Media. Springer and the American College of Medical Toxicology sign publishing deal - November 25, 2009
STM publisher Springer, Germany, has signed an agreement with the American College of Medical Toxicology (ACMT). Under the deal, Springer will publish the latter’s official journal, Journal of Medical Toxicology (JMT), beginning in March 2010.
